Captain ~ Affectionate Boy Full of Fun – 3yo Black Greyhound

CAPTAIN

Captain is a 3 year old ex-racing greyhound boy who is now retired and waiting to begin his ‘family pet’ career. He has a lovely, affectionate face and a soft black coat that is going to be just gorgeous once he gets a bit more sheen to it.

Captain is a truly lovely dog and a real pet. He is lively and full of fun, but not overly hyper or unmannered. He adores being around people and likes to follow you around. He lives for one-on-one time with his people and will stroke you with his paw if you forget to pet him!



Captain gets on well with the other dogs in our kennels and is generally an easy going boy who is content to go with the flow and do what you’re doing. He has not been tested yet with smaller dogs or cats, but these can be carried out prior to adoption if required.

Dear Captain has spent all his life so far in kennels, so new owners will need to be a bit patient at the start and give him time to settle in to the new environment. It generally takes greyhounds 10-14 days to start to settle in a home, and really all they need is time and patience. We know Captain is going to just adore all the attention and fuss of a loving forever home.

In general greyhounds are calm, mannerly dogs that are well used to being handled. They can fit very well in to a wide range of different lifestyles and usually adjust to the home life very quickly. Their soft, easy going nature often makes them ideal to live in a family with children, while their love of lazing around and low exercise requirements can make them perfect for the elderly. Greyhounds also don’t shed as much as other more popular dog breeds and this can make them suitable to live with allergy sufferers.

~~ KERRY GREYHOUND CONNECTION ~~

Kerry Greyhound Connection is a small voluntary organisation based in County Kerry, Ireland and Norfolk, England. It operates through a network of volunteers spaced over Ireland, the UK and mainland Europe. We can look after approximately 70 greyhounds at any one time, in Ireland and the UK.

Each dog is neutered, vaccinated, microchipped and given a full veterinary check before being adopted.
We assess the suitability of all home offers, and we have homed greyhounds in Ireland, the UK, Central Europe and the USA.
